> Different results are seen for the same query over CSV data file and another CSV data file created by CTAS using the same CSV file.
> Tests were executed on 4 node cluster on CentOS.
> I got rid of the header information that is written by CTAS into the new CSV file that CTAS creates, and then ran my queries over CTAS' CSV file.
> query over uncompressed CSV file, deletions/deletions-00000-of-00020.csv
> {code}
> > select count(cast(columns[0] as double)),max(cast(columns[0] as double)),min(cast(columns[0] as double)),avg(cast(columns[0] as double)), columns[7] from `deletions/deletions-00000-of-00020.csv` group by columns[7];
> 88 rows selected (6.893 seconds)
> =================================================
> {code}
> query over CSV file that was created by CTAS. (input to CTAS was deletions/deletions-00000-of-00020.csv)
> Notice there is one more record returned.
> {code}
> > select count(cast(columns[0] as double)),max(cast(columns[0] as double)),min(cast(columns[0] as double)),avg(cast(columns[0] as double)), columns[7] from `csvToCSV_00000_of_00020/0_0_0.csv` group by columns[7];
>  
> 89 rows selected (6.623 seconds)
> ==================================================
> {code}
> query over compressed CSV file
> {code}
> > select count(cast(columns[0] as double)),max(cast(columns[0] as double)),min(cast(columns[0] as double)),avg(cast(columns[0] as double)), columns[7] from `deletions-00000-of-00020.csv.gz` group by columns[7];
> 88 rows selected (10.526 seconds)
> ==================================================
> {code}
> In the below cases, the count and sum results are different when query is executed over CSV file that was created by CTAS. ( this may explain why we see the difference in results in the above queries ? )
